How to Prepare Mentally and Physically for Skydiving
Getting your mind and body ready can make your jump smoother and more enjoyable.
Start by understanding the physical requirements—being in decent health and having no serious medical conditions helps.
Mentally, reminding yourself that safety measures are in place and that professionals handle most risks reduces anxiety.
Here are some actionable steps to prepare:
- Ensure you are physically fit by doing light exercise and staying hydrated before your jump.
- Practice breathing exercises or meditation to calm nerves and stay focused.
- Familiarize yourself with the jump process through videos or reading material provided by your school.
- Confirm all paperwork, waivers, and health declarations are completed correctly before the jump.
- Discuss any fears or concerns openly with your instructor—they’re used to helping nervous jumpers.
- Get a good night’s sleep before the day of your jump to ensure alertness and energy.
- Wear comfortable, weather-appropriate clothing and avoid heavy accessories or jewelry.
